Frequently Asked Question
What should I include in a condolence message?
Express your sympathy and acknowledge the loss. Share a fond memory or highlight the positive impact the deceased had. Offer your support and let them know you’re thinking of them.
How can I make my condolence message more personal?
Include specific memories or qualities of the deceased that you admired. Mention how their loss has affected you personally and offer concrete ways you can support them during this time.
Is it appropriate to mention religion or spirituality in a condolence message?
It depends on your relationship with the bereaved and their beliefs. If you know they hold specific religious or spiritual beliefs, offering a message of peace or divine comfort can be appropriate. Otherwise, keep the message general and respectful.
How should I address the recipient in a condolence message?
Use a respectful and comforting tone. Address them by their name or a term of endearment you are comfortable with, such as “Dear [Name].” Maintain a tone of empathy and support throughout the message.
What are some examples of comforting phrases to include?
“I am so sorry for your loss.” “Please accept my deepest condolences.” “May you find comfort in the love and support around you.” “My heart goes out to you during this difficult time.”
When is it appropriate to send a condolence message?
Send your message as soon as you learn about the death. It’s best to send it within the first few weeks, but don’t worry if some time has passed; a message of support is always appreciated.
Should I include an offer of help in my condolence message?
Yes, offering practical help can be very supportive. Mention specific ways you can assist, such as preparing meals, helping with errands, or simply being there to listen. Make sure your offer is genuine and specific.
